Houston, Texas (KTRK) – A man was shot dead after being robbed by three men outside a club in North Houston early Saturday.

Houston Police Department officers say the initial disruption occurred at about 2:30 a.m. outside the Vulcan Club near I-45 and West Little York.

Police said the victim and two of his friends were in the club’s car park when three men approached them and stole a necklace from one of them.

After the theft, the suspects took off in a gray F350, according to HPD.

Police said the group of friends then decided to pursue the suspects, leading them to a standstill on Maybank Drive and Silber Road, and they became trapped.

The Public Health Service (HPD) says it happened when the shooting took place and the victim was shot multiple times by at least two suspects.

The victim was taken to the hospital where he was pronounced dead.

Authorities said they are looking for the thieves who escaped.
